TL;DW

Visuals:

- All consoles have Temporal up-scaling and dynamic resolution scaling. .
- Base XBO has the worst image quality and most image breakup.
- Best image quality: XBX with Pro a close second.

- Base XBO: 900p to 684p
- XBX: 2016p to 1440p.
- Base PS4: 1080p to 864p
- Pro: 1620p to 1296p

- SSR quality and texture filtering lower on base consoles.
- Otherwise the physics, NPC count etc all appear same between all consoles.

Performance:

- Base XBO has near consistent drops to mid to low 20's and tearing during driving and combat.
- Base PS4 is a 'big improvement' but w/ adaptive screen tear and mild 1 to 2 FPS drops.
- XBX is mostly consistent with barely some drops to mid 20's when causing commotion.
- PS4 Pro has the fewest drops and the least tearing and best playing version.
